Einstein Never Used Flashcards: It's not anti-flashcard, but it is anti-fad-based-parenting. Lots of great info on how babies' brains develop, how they really learn, and how achievement-oriented parenting got sidetracked by political agendas and scientific sound-bites.

Creme Fraiche: less sour and lighter than sour cream, I can't believe I was 25 before my first creme fraiche experience. I dollop it over fresh berries with a sprinkle of unrefined sugar. Oo-la-la!

The Guernsey Literary and Potato Peel Pie Society: Heartwarming, touching, and just downright funny, this book provides a constant stream of chuckles punctuated with a few good belly-laughs in just the right places. The beautiful story explores the power of literature during a time of great stress.
